6 The Board of Supervisors of Contra Costa County,California,by vote of two-thirds or more
7 of its members, RESOLVES that:
8 Pursuant to Government Code section 25350.5 and Streets& Highways Code section 943,
9 Contra Costa County in conjunction with the Contra Costa Transportation Authority and Caltrans
10 intend to construct a road project, a public improvement, that consists of adding two new lanes,
I I which will carry westbound traffic,north of the existing,two lane highway more commonly known
12 as Franklin Canyon Road in the Hercules area, and, in connection therewith, acquire interests in
13 certain real property.
14 The properties to be acquired consist of 15 parcels and are generally located in the Hercules
15 area. The said properties are more particularly described in Appendix "A", attached hereto and
16 incorporated herein by this reference.
17 On February 18, 1999,notice of the County's intention to adopt a resolution of necessity for
18 acquisition by eminent domain of the real property described in Appendix"A"was sent to persons
19 whose names appear on the last equalized County Assessment Roll as owners of said property. The
20 notice specified March 9, 1999, at 9:00 a.m. in the Board of Supervisors Chambers in the
21 Administration Building,651 Pine Street,Martinez,California,as the time and place for the hearing
22 thereon.
23 The hearing was held at that time and place, and all interested parties were given an
24 opportunity to be heard and based upon the evidence presented to it, this Board finds, determines
25 and hereby declares the following:
26 1. The public interest and necessity require the proposed project, and
27 2. The proposed project is planned and located in the manner which will be most
28 compatible with the greatest public good and the least private injury; and

1 3. The property described herein is necessary for the proposed project; and
2 4. The offer required by Section 7267.2 of the Government Code was made to the
3 owner or owners of record.
4 5. Insofar as any of the property described in this resolution has heretofore been
r
5 dedicated to a public use, the acquisition and use of such property by Contra Costa
6 County for highway purposes is for a more necessary public use than the use to
7 which the property has already been appropriated or for a compatible public use.
8 This determination and finding is made and this resolution is adopted pursuant to
9 Code of Civil Procedure sections 1240.510 and 1240.610.
10 The County Counsel of this County is hereby AUTHORIZED and EMPOWERED:
11 To acquire in the County's name, by condemnation,the titles, easements and rights of way
12 hereinafter described in and to said real property or interest(s) therein, in accordance with the
13 provisions for eminent domain in the Code of Civil Procedure and the Constitution of California:
14 Parcels 1, 3,4, 6, 7, 10,and 11 are to be acquired in fee title.
15 Parcels 8, 12, and 15 are to be acquired as permanent easements.
16 Parcels 2, 5,9, 13, and 14 are to be acquired as temporary construction easements.
17 To prepare and prosecute in the County's name such proceedings in the proper court as are
18 necessary for such acquisition;
19 To deposit the probable amount of compensation based on an appraisal,and to apply to said
20 court for an order permitting the County to take immediate possession and use said real property for
21 said public uses and purposes.
